    To insure proper sanitation, all removable parts on the can opener should be detached and cleaned thoroughly in warm, sudsy water at regular intervals. Before cleaning, UNPLUG THE CORD FROM OUTLET. The motor housing easily wipes clean using a damp cloth. Never immerse the motor housing in water.     Twist the knob to raise and lower the cutting assembly. To adjust the height of the cutting assembly follow these directions: 1. Twist the knob in a counter-clockwise direction until the knob clicks into place. The cutting assembly Is raised for opening extra tall cans. 2.
